Application Data Protection as a Service for OpenStack
Project description
Karbor
Application Data Protection as a Service for OpenStack
Mission Statement
To protect the Data and Metadata that comprises an OpenStack-deployed Application against loss/damage (e.g. backup, replication) by providing a standard framework of APIs and services that allows vendors to provide plugins through a unified interface
Open Architecture
Design for multiple perspectives:
User: Protect App Deployment
Configure and manage custom protection plans on the deployed resources (topology, VMs, volumes, images, …)
Admin: Define Protectable Resources
Decide what plugins protect which resources, what is available for the user
Decide where users can protect their resources
Vendors: Standard API for protection products
Create plugins that implement Protection mechanisms for different OpenStack resources
Links
Free software: Apache license
Documentation: https://docs.openstack.org/karbor/latest/
Admin guide: https://docs.openstack.org/karbor/latest/admin/index.html
Bugs: https://storyboard.openstack.org/#!/project/openstack/karbor
Release notes: https://docs.openstack.org/karbor/latest/releasenotes.html
Features
Version 0.1
Resource API
Plan API
Bank API
Ledger API
Cross-resource dependencies
Limitations
Only 1 Bank plugin per Protection Plan
Automatic object discovery not supported
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
File details
Details for the file karbor-1.6.0.tar.gz
.
File metadata
- Download URL: karbor-1.6.0.tar.gz
- Upload date:
- Size: 6.8 MB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/3.2.0 pkginfo/1.5.0.1 requests/2.24.0 setuptools/49.2.0 requests-toolbelt/0.9.1 tqdm/4.50.0 CPython/3.7.8
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 33540b3178968f9a0f4db016ffbb5cd646b25b54935bfcbbb8927e75e348e2bf |
|
MD5 | d4a9c1b2294865b630a55a751e56f080 |
|
BLAKE2b-256 | 1f550964d6129992e657099540ebf931d6b7d2a71f3ff774fcf39736d419d0e3 |
File details
Details for the file karbor-1.6.0-py3-none-any.whl
.
File metadata
- Download URL: karbor-1.6.0-py3-none-any.whl
- Upload date:
- Size: 544.6 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/3.2.0 pkginfo/1.5.0.1 requests/2.24.0 setuptools/49.2.0 requests-toolbelt/0.9.1 tqdm/4.50.0 CPython/3.7.8
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| c250ff5f6054b5d42cb2def6c0a6b828251ea78290b989f13df452a5ed3671bf |
|
MD5 | fe2b33211ea0cdcc5795a5392ab331eb |
|
BLAKE2b-256 | 313e2cb592a6d11c7b71024ab7f546d7c862e9828835f01d5eaef32ea8d59cf8 |